Description
In the Linux kernel, the following vulnerability has been resolved: ALSA: usb-audio: qcom: clear opened when stream enable fails On enable, subs->opened is set before the service_interval is validated; an invalid interval jumps to the response label without clearing it, so the substream is wedged at -EBUSY until a disable or disconnect. Clear subs->opened on the enable error path.
